Matches in DBpedia 2016-04 for { ?s ?p "Spalding War Memorial is a First World War memorial in the gardens of Ayscoughfee Hall in Spalding, Lincolnshire, in eastern England. The memorial was designed by the architect Sir Edwin Lutyens in a departure from the usual style of Lutyens' war memorials. The proposal for a war memorial in Spalding originated in January 1918 with Barbara McLaren, whose husband and the town's Member of Parliament Francis McLaren was killed in the war."@en }
